ZAHA HADID
This installation in Miami is called “Elastika” and is site specific to the building. The building is the historical Moore building, built in 1921. The design, done in 2005, is over four stories to look like ‘stretched chewing gum’.

Daniel Widrig
In his work collaborating with Nike, Daniel Widrig created a very appealing 3D Print. It is a four meter long sculpture that was presented at an expo. I found it very interesting how he designed the piece so that it can inflate and deflate, making it very efficient for things like exhibitions. Daniel stated that creating a third of it took 20 hours.
